The Current State of SOA Governance
As organizations begin to adopt service-oriented architectures (SOA), the topic of SOA governance -- the articulation and enforcement of policies related to Web-service lifecycles, implementation protocols, service access, information protection and service-level agreements -- is receiving an increasing amount of attention. ebizQ conducted this online survey in August 2006 in order to understand the current state of SOA governance from the practitioner’s point of view. White Paper Abstract - The Current State of SOA Governance
This paper shares the results of the August 2006 SOA Governance Survey, along with ebizQ's observations on current SOA trends.
The SOA survey revealed that while most organizations are doing something related to SOA, only a third of respondents classified their SOA adoption stage as deployed, while 65% are actively pursuing SOA in the form of planning, pilots or production deployments. Less than 20% of respondents have more than 50 services in production.
While 85% of organizations have, or will soon have, a corporate governance mandate, few have formalized governance roles and 70% are enforcing governance manually. Survey respondents recognize this discontinuity as only 17% characterized their SOA governance strategy as sufficient.
It is clear from this survey, and from the growth of SOA adoption across industries, that governance is a timely issue, and one to which organizations need to begin to pay attention.
